250209 Sermon Questions

Bible study dates: 2-9-25 - Jeff Ellis
Bible study Themes: “Giving Out God’s Provision” – Mark 6
APOSTLES DOCTRINE(WORD)
  • THROUGH THE BIBLE READING
  •  Mark 6:7-13
  • God has given us His power to put on display so that people would repent and enter into His kingdom. Are you freely giving out what God has given you so that others may know Him and become His child? (See Mt. 10:5-15; 5:16; 1 Pet.2:11-12; 4:10-11)

  •  Mark 6:30-34
  • Jesus gave out the teaching and the truth the Father had given Him to lost, directionless, hopeless people in desperate need of truth. God has given us His eternal Word and the command to teach in some capacity. Where are you planting the seed of His Word? (See Mt. 28:19-20; Deut. 11:19-21; Mk. 4:26-29; Eph. 6:4)

  •  Mark 6:34
  • Have you underestimated the power of teaching God’s Word by His Spirit? It is what equips us for every good work and the work of the ministry. Jesus said it is the one thing that is needed. Don’t let listening to teachings or reading become a religious habit, but rather having ears to hear what His Spirit is saying to you now.
  • (See 2 Tim. 3:16-17; Eph. 4:11-16; Is. 55:11)

  • Jesus wants to be your provision in all things. Don’t miss out on what God has for you by focusing on the little you have. Bring God your lack and He will supply the need.
  • (See 2Co 3:5-6; Phil. 4:19)
